Wipeout Pure for Sony PSP offers an exhilarating anti-gravity racing experience with eight unique race-crafts, 16 futuristic environments, and robust multiplayer capabilities, allowing players to compete in high-speed races and unlock new content.

Review - Wipeout Pure
I was so excited to finally get this game in the mail. I could not wait to open it and play it, but when I sat down and played it, I absolutely hated it and wound up putting it down almost instantly. I wanted to love it, I tried my hardest to like it, I even tried to force myself to like it, but I can't do it.First, controlling the vehicles is not too bad, the schematics are pretty good. However the handeling of the vehicles is an absolute nightmare. There is no middle ground, the vehicles either have a horrible handeling in which you cant turn quickly and bang into walls every 3 feet or they have too much handeling where you are swerving all over the track banging into walls every 3 feet from over compensating the controls. And yes, I know you have to use the air brake system, but who the hell wants to use that through the whole race, I want speed not brakes and percision.This leads me to my second point.. The tracks. The worlds are magnificient and the graphics are absolutely awesome, however the tracks are so skinny and narrow. Forget about the control with a good handeling vehicle, try navigating the tracks with the Pirhana who has the worst handeling, its impossible. Secondly the tracks are so linear, straight and boring. Different, but Surprisingly Fun and Challenging.
This is a game that is very different as it's not purely just racing. At first I was annoyed and thought I had wasted my money, but I gave it another chance and really began to enjoy it. There are many course, but most are locked, which make the game more challenging. I don't like it when everything is open to me, I want to earn it and as I progress further I feel a sense of accomplishment. Weapons and power ups are included, which is why I said it's not just a racing game. Some of the weapons are annoying and can really tip the balance, but you can learn to avoid some of them, which just makes the game more challenging. I know these is a previous version of this game, with this new one having additional features. I do intend to buy the first on, but I have become very happy with this game. It has it's flaws and takes getting use to, but it really is fun.

Fast-Paced Racing in a Sci-Fi World
I really like racing games, but only particular kinds. I'm not big on the realistic ones like Gran Tourismo. Nothing wrong with them, they're just not my bag.Mario Kart and Burnout. Those are the two titles that first come to mind. I like stuff that's different, that has cool cars and items and just an indescribable sense of "Yeah, I like this."Wipeout Pure is not the first in the series. The N64 one is pretty cool. But this is first one that I've really gotten into. I love the music, I love the menu designs, I love the futuristic vehicles, I love the weapons, I love how you can absorb items to recover health, and I love the race courses.It's not too hard so far, though I do have to perform a few practice runs before really tackling the tournaments. All the vehicles have different pros and cons, and it's fun to try out the different ones on different tracks.And it plays really well on the PSP. A great game to have on trips for quick pick-up-and-play fun.
